URLs - still worth serious money?


Help me with this, please. Do you seriously think having a certain URL will boost traffic?

I'm not asking whether this or that search engine algorithm factors domain names into its ranking for relevancy. I'm asking if you think that enough people navigate by typing URLs such that traffic will spike if one registers motherofpearl.com instead of joesexoticmarketplace-motherofpearlproducts.com.

Of course, we know the common wisdom - the entire domain name registration and sale business is based on certain assumptions: go with short names, easy to remember, easy to type, comes to mind generically. But is this based on research?

I don't navigate by typing; I use favorites functionality and search results. Since 1997, I have met exactly one person who typed first, searched later.

Has anyone ever seen a study on this? If so, drop a comment below. No glittering generalities, please.
